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 200 °C top/bottom heat.
  2. Sieve the flour, baking powder and salt into a bowl.
  3. Cut the butter into small pieces.
  4. Add the sugar, egg and butter to the flour mixture and mix quickly. The dough should just about hold together. Small pieces of butter in the dough are perfectly ok.
  5. Using lightly floured hands, shape the dough into six roughly equal-sized balls and place them side by side, a little apart, on a baking tray lined with baking paper.
  6. Bake in a hot oven for approx. 15 minutes until golden brown. Remove and leave to cool on a wire rack.
  7. Wash and slice the strawberries. Cut the scones in half and spread with cream cheese. Spread the jam on top and sprinkle with mint or pistachios as desired.
